HowtoCeph: mettre à jour gestion des nœuds

This commit is contained in:
Alexis Ben Miloud--Josselin 2023-04-19 12:10:41 +02:00
parent 125fef17e3
commit 0810195ddc

View file

@ -306,51 +306,36 @@ EOF
# Gestion des nœuds
## Redémarrer Ceph
## Redémarrer un serveur Ceph
Pour redémarrer tous les services du cluster faire, sur tous les nœuds du cluster :
Si on souhaite redémarrer un des nœuds du _cluster_, on commence par désactiver le _balancing_ du _cluster_ temporairement. L'objectif est d'empêcher le _cluster_ de répliquer les objects perdus ailleurs. Sur une des machines :
~~~
# systemctl stop ceph\*.service ceph\*.target
# systemctl start ceph.target
~~~
Pour plus de détails : [Operating a Cluster](http://docs.ceph.com/docs/luminous/rados/operations/operating/).
## Redémarrer un nœud
Si on souhaite redémarrer un des nœuds du cluster, on commence par désactiver le balancing du cluster temporairement. L'objectif est d'empêcher le cluster de répliquer les objects perdus ailleurs. Sur un des nœuds :
~~~
# ceph osd set noout
# ceph osd set norebalance
~~~
Sur le nœud à éteindre :
Sur la machine à éteindre :
~~~
# reboot
~~~
Quand la machine est de nouveau disponible, on vérifie l'état du cluster. Il faut que les pgs soient `active+clean`. Sur un des nœuds :
Quand la machine est de nouveau disponible, vérifier l'état du _cluster_. Il faut que les PG soient `active+clean`. Sur une des machines :
~~~
# ceph -s
~~~
Puis réactiver le balancing du cluster.
Puis réactiver le _balancing_ du _cluster_.
~~~
# ceph osd unset noout
# ceph osd unset norebalance
~~~
Pour finir, on s'assure que tout va bien :
## Redémarrer les services Ceph
~~~
# ceph status
~~~
TODO section à mettre à jour
Pour redémarrer tous les services du _cluster_ faire, sur tous les nœuds du cluster :
# systemctl stop ceph\*.service ceph\*.target
# systemctl start ceph.target
Pour plus de détails : [Operating a Cluster](http://docs.ceph.com/docs/luminous/rados/operations/operating/).
# Gestion des comptes utilisateurs